I've been working on rebuilding my track for the past couple of months and it's finally done! Well I still need to clean up the sides of the track to make it look nicer but for the most part it's finished. I've got close to 2000 yards of dirt in the track now (I know it doesn't look like it) but there is a lot of elevation change that I added from my old layout. For those if you in michigan I'll be having some open practice dates in the near future (sorry not a real track with real racing) and I'll post them here. For the mods I put this thread in this forum because I only run electric and when I open it up to others I'll only be allowing electric, atleast for the time being. I want to test the waters with the neighbors before I end up with a dozen nitro 1/8 scale runinng around the track at the same time! I hope you guys like the pics.
